1.1 开源软件和比特币钱包的背景
1.2 优势和重要性
2.1 安装所需的开发工具和环境
2.2 钱包创建过程的详细步骤
3.1 导入/创建钱包
3.2 接收比特币
3.3 发送比特币
3.4 备份和恢复钱包
4.1 使用强密码
4.2 加密钱包
4.3 使用多重签名
4.4 定期更新和备份钱包
5.1 如何选择适合的开源比特币钱包项目?
5.2 开源比特币钱包的优点和缺点是什么?
5.3 如何防止比特币钱包被黑客攻击?
5.4 如何处理比特币钱包丢失的情况?
5.5 是否有风险使用开源比特币钱包?
1.1 开源软件和比特币钱包的背景
开源软件是指可以被任何人查看、修改和分发的软件。比特币钱包是存储、发送和接收比特币的工具。开源比特币钱包项目允许开发人员参与贡献和改进,提高了安全性和可靠性。
1.2 优势和重要性
开源比特币钱包项目的优势包括透明度、安全性和可定制性。开源代码可以被独立审查,确保没有后门或恶意代码。用户可以自行编译和验证代码的安全性。开源钱包项目也鼓励更多开发者的参与,推动创新和改进。
2.1 安装所需的开发工具和环境
在创建开源比特币钱包之前,需要安装开发工具和环境,包括编程语言和相关库。常见的开发工具包括Python、Node.js和Java。
2.2 钱包创建过程的详细步骤
详细步骤包括生成比特币地址、创建钱包文件、设置密码等。通过执行这些步骤,用户可以创建自己的开源比特币钱包。
3.1 导入/创建钱包
用户可以导入现有的比特币钱包,也可以创建新的钱包。导入钱包需要提供私钥或助记词,创建钱包则需要生成新的私钥。
3.2 接收比特币
开源比特币钱包提供用户接收比特币的功能,每个用户都可以获得自己的比特币地址,其他人可以通过该地址向其发送比特币。
3.3 发送比特币
用户可以使用开源比特币钱包发送比特币给其他人。在发送过程中,用户需要提供接收方的比特币地址和发送金额。
3.4 备份和恢复钱包
为了防止钱包丢失,用户应定期备份钱包文件或记录私钥/助记词。在需要恢复钱包时,用户可以使用备份文件或私钥/助记词。
4.1 使用强密码
用户应该使用强密码来保护开源比特币钱包,确保只有授权人员可以访问钱包。
4.2 加密钱包
开源比特币钱包支持对钱包文件进行加密,增加了数据的安全性。
4.3 使用多重签名
开源比特币钱包可以使用多重签名功能,在进行交易时需要多个授权,提高了安全性。
4.4 定期更新和备份钱包
用户应定期更新开源比特币钱包以获取最新的安全补丁,同时定期备份钱包来防止丢失。
5.1 如何选择适合的开源比特币钱包项目?
选择适合的开源比特币钱包项目应考虑安全性、功能、用户界面和社区支持等因素。
5.2 开源比特币钱包的优点和缺点是什么?
开源比特币钱包的优点包括安全性和可定制性,缺点包括技术要求和可能的用户界面不友好。
5.3 如何防止比特币钱包被黑客攻击?
用户应使用强密码、加密钱包、定期更新钱包并避免使用不受信任的网络或设备。
5.4 如何处理比特币钱包丢失的情况?
用户应使用备份文件或私钥/助记词来恢复钱包,如果无法找回钱包,则无法恢复其中的比特币。
5.5 是否有风险使用开源比特币钱包?
开源比特币钱包的安全性取决于用户的操作和环境,如果用户不小心处理钱包或使用不安全的设备,则可能存在风险。
leave a reply